码迷,mamicode.com
首页 > Web开发 > 详细

PHP – PDO函数简介

时间:2017-07-30 21:07:57      阅读:201      评论:0      收藏:0      [点我收藏+]

标签:metadata   rom   添加   tin   const   ack   数组   结果   ado   

PDO(PHP Data Objects)是一个“数据库访问抽象层”,作用是统一各种数据库的访问接口,与mysql和mysqli的函数库相比,PDO让跨数据库的使用更具有亲和力;与ADODB和MDB2相比,PDO更高效。目前而言,实现“数据库抽象层”任重而道远,使用PDO这样的“数据库访问抽象层”是一个不错的选择。

PHP 6将默认使用PDO来处理数据库,把所有的数据库扩展移到了PECL



PDO->beginTransaction() — 标明回滚起始点 
PDO->commit() — 标明回滚结束点,并执行SQL 
PDO->__construct() — 建立一个PDO链接数据库的实例 
PDO->errorCode() — 获取错误码 
PDO->errorInfo() — 获取错误的信息 
PDO->exec() — 处理一条SQL语句,并返回所影响的条目数 
PDO->getAttribute() — 获取一个“数据库连接对象”的属性 
PDO->getAvailableDrivers() — 获取有效的PDO驱动器名称 
PDO->lastInsertId() — 获取写入的最后一条数据的主键值 
PDO->prepare() — 生成一个“查询对象” 
PDO->query() — 处理一条SQL语句,并返回一个“PDOStatement” 
PDO->quote() — 为某个SQL中的字符串添加引号 
PDO->rollBack() — 执行回滚 
PDO->setAttribute() — 为一个“数据库连接对象”设定属性 
PDOStatement->bindColumn() — 将PHP的变量绑定到数据库中的列
PDOStatement->bindParam() — 绑定一个指定参数的变量名称
PDOStatement->bindValue() — 将一个参数值绑定 
PDOStatement->closeCursor() — 关闭游标,使声明再次被运行。 
PDOStatement->columnCount() — 返回列数的结果集
PDOStatement->errorCode() — Fetch the SQLSTATE associated with the last operation on the statement handle 
PDOStatement->errorInfo() — Fetch extended error information associated with the last operation on the statement handle 
PDOStatement->execute() — 执行一个准备好的查询对象
PDOStatement->fetch() — 获取下一行的结果集 
PDOStatement->fetchAll() — 返回一个数组包含所有的结果集列
PDOStatement->fetchColumn() — Returns a single column from the next row of a result set 
PDOStatement->fetchObject() — Fetches the next row and returns it as an object. 
PDOStatement->getAttribute() — Retrieve a statement attribute 
PDOStatement->getColumnMeta() — Returns metadata for a column in a result set 
PDOStatement->nextRowset() — Advances to the next rowset in a multi-rowset statement handle 
PDOStatement->rowCount() — 由过去的SQL语句返回行数
PDOStatement->setAttribute() — 声明属性集 
PDOStatement->setFetchMode() — Set the default fetch mode for this statement

PHP – PDO函数简介

标签:metadata   rom   添加   tin   const   ack   数组   结果   ado   

原文地址:http://www.cnblogs.com/limingxishuai666/p/7260297.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!